What to eat in Nevada : Top Picks

1. Shrimp Cocktail: A classic appetizer in Nevada, the shrimp cocktail is a must-try. Fresh, succulent shrimp served with a tangy cocktail sauce, it’s a perfect start to any meal.

2. Prime Rib: Nevada is known for its excellent beef, and the prime rib is a testament to this. Slow-roasted to perfection, this juicy cut of beef is a carnivore’s delight.

3. Chicken Wings: A popular bar food in Nevada, chicken wings come in a variety of flavors. From spicy buffalo to sweet barbecue, there’s a wing for every palate.

4. Lobster Bisque: This creamy, rich soup is a staple in many of Nevada’s upscale restaurants. Made with fresh lobster, it’s a luxurious treat for seafood lovers.

5. Nevada-style Pizza: Nevada’s take on pizza features a thin, crispy crust and a variety of unique toppings. It’s a must-try for pizza enthusiasts.

6. Basque Chateaubriand: A nod to Nevada’s Basque heritage, this tender cut of beef is typically served with a rich, flavorful sauce and a side of potatoes.

7. Nevada Picon Punch: While not a food, this traditional Basque cocktail is a must-try. Made with brandy, grenadine, and a splash of soda, it’s a refreshing accompaniment to any meal.

8. All-You-Can-Eat Sushi: Nevada, especially Las Vegas, is famous for its all-you-can-eat sushi spots. Fresh, high-quality sushi at a great price – what’s not to love?

9. Chiles Rellenos: A popular dish in Nevada’s Mexican restaurants, chiles rellenos are stuffed peppers that are battered and fried. They’re a spicy, satisfying treat.

10. Nevada Beef Jerky: This isn’t your average convenience store jerky. Nevada’s version is made with high-quality beef and a variety of flavorful marinades. It’s a perfect snack for on-the-go.
